This was the 2nd sold out night at the Kessler for Hayes & Heathens -- a growing collaboration between Hayes Carll and The Band of Heathens. Save for a brief interlude when the Heathens took a brief break offstage (save for the keyboard player, the excellent Trevor Nealon), entire set consisted of both Hayes Carll and The Band of Heathens sharing the stage and trading off both Hayes Carll numbers and The Bank of Heathens numbers. The collaboration makes for an excellent set: the Hayes Carll numbers really stand out with the added layers of the excellent musicianship and vocals of The Band of Heathens, and The Band of Heathens numbers can focus on some of their standouts with the unique twang of Hayes Carll adding even more layers. The vocalists all complemented each other, and each had standout moments that highlighted their individual strengths as well as how well they all sang together. Really outstanding set for a highly engaged audience. Some of the standout numbers: "L.A. County Blues", "Jackson Station", "Look at Miss Ohio" (The Band of Heathens songs); "KMAG YOYO", "You Get It All", "Stomp and Holler" (Hayes Carll songs). The Band of Heathens is an excellent live band, with essentially two lead vocalists and lead guitar players who share the stage and complement each other very well, along with an excellent supporting cast. I highly recommend catching this band live whenever you can, and Hayes and The Heathens is a really excellent concert experience.

About The Band of Heathens
The Band of Heathens are an American rock 'n' roll band from Austin, Texas
since 2005. Founding members Ed Jurdi and Gordy Quist remain at the center of
the band as primary songwriters and guitarists along with Trevor Nealon on keys
who has been with the band since 2008. In 2009 the band was invited to record
an episode of Austin City Limits on the heels of the release of their album, One
Foot In The Ether. The band has found continued success almost 20 years into
their existence, the most recent being the release of their critically-acclaimed new
album, Simple Things (BOH Records, 2023), and their recording of the song
"Hurricane" was just certified gold by the R.I.A.A. (from Top Hat Crown & the
Clapmaster's Son, 2011). Simple Things sat at #1 on the official Americana radio
chart for 2 months in 2023 and in the top 10 for almost half of the year.
The Simple Things album release also earned the band a national TV
appearance on CBS Saturday Morning, and added to their already impressive
streaming numbers. The band's discography has been collectively streamed
close to a billion times. The Band of Heathens has remained fiercely independent
from day one, turning down record deals and forging their own path in the world
on their own terms.
